Falmouth, VA is a small town located in Stafford County. It is home to many different religious congregations that provide spiritual and emotional support to the local community. These churches range from traditional Baptist and Presbyterian denominations to smaller independent churches of various faiths. The churches of Falmouth are active in providing worship services, charitable activities, education programs, and social gatherings for their members. Programs such as Vacation Bible School or youth groups offer opportunities for children and teenagers to participate in faith-based activities while adults can join in mission trips or attend Bible studies. Churches also use their resources to offer mentorship programs, food drives, clothing drives, and other initiatives that benefit the local community. In short, the churches of Falmouth are an important part of the fabric of this small town.
